Matt Clifford, the chair of the UK's AI policy advisory board, has resigned due to concerns over a conflict of interest. Clifford recently took on a new full-time role at Anthropic, an AI company, which raised disquiet among senior Members of Parliament. His departure follows scrutiny over his dual role in shaping UK AI policy while also working for a major AI firm. AI
